探索人脸识别网址:技术、应用与安全指南
2025.09.18 14:30浏览量:0简介:本文深入探讨人脸识别网址的技术原理、应用场景及安全实践,为开发者与企业用户提供从基础到进阶的实用指南。
一、人脸识别网址的技术内核:从算法到部署
人脸识别网址的核心是基于人脸特征提取与比对的生物识别技术,其技术链可分为三个层次:
1.1 底层算法:特征提取与模型训练
现代人脸识别系统普遍采用深度学习模型(如FaceNet、ArcFace),通过卷积神经网络(CNN)提取人脸的128维或更高维特征向量。例如,FaceNet模型通过三元组损失(Triplet Loss)优化特征空间,使得同一人的特征距离小于不同人的特征距离。开发者可通过开源框架(如TensorFlow、PyTorch)训练自定义模型,或直接调用预训练模型。
代码示例(Python+OpenCV):
import cv2
import face_recognition
# 加载图像并提取特征
image = face_recognition.load_image_file("person.jpg")
face_encodings = face_recognition.face_encodings(image)[0] # 获取128维特征向量
print("Feature vector:", face_encodings[:5]) # 输出前5维特征
1.2 中间层:API与SDK集成
多数人脸识别服务提供RESTful API或SDK,开发者可通过HTTP请求或本地库调用功能。例如,某云服务的人脸识别API可能支持以下操作:
- 人脸检测:返回人脸位置、关键点(如眼睛、鼻子坐标)。
- 特征比对:计算两张人脸的相似度分数(0-100)。
- 活体检测:通过动作指令(如转头、眨眼)防止照片攻击。
API调用示例(伪代码):
```python
import requests
url = “https://api.example.com/face/compare“
payload = {
“image1”: “base64_encoded_image1”,
“image2”: “base64_encoded_image2”
}
response = requests.post(url, json=payload)
print(“Similarity score:”, response.json()[“score”])
#### 1.3 部署层:云端与边缘计算
人脸识别网址的部署需考虑延迟、成本与隐私:
- **云端部署**:适合高并发场景(如机场安检),但需依赖网络稳定性。
- **边缘部署**:在本地设备(如门禁机)运行模型,减少数据传输,适合隐私敏感场景。
### 二、人脸识别网址的应用场景:从安全到体验升级
#### 2.1 安全认证:替代密码与令牌
人脸识别已广泛应用于金融、政务领域。例如,某银行APP通过人脸识别完成转账验证,用户只需面对手机摄像头,系统在3秒内完成活体检测与比对,错误率低于0.001%。
**实施建议**:
- 结合多因素认证(如人脸+短信验证码)。
- 定期更新模型以应对化妆、年龄变化等干扰。
#### 2.2 公共安全:智慧城市与刑侦
公安系统通过人脸识别网址实现实时布控。例如,某城市在交通枢纽部署摄像头,系统与犯罪数据库比对,每秒可处理200张人脸图像,准确率达99.7%。
**技术挑战**:
- 遮挡(口罩、墨镜)处理:需训练支持部分遮挡的模型。
- 群体场景优化:通过多目标跟踪算法减少计算冗余。
#### 2.3 商业营销:个性化推荐与客流分析
零售门店利用人脸识别分析顾客年龄、性别,动态调整广告内容。例如,某商场的智能屏根据观众特征播放不同商品广告,转化率提升15%。
**隐私合规建议**:
- 明确告知用户数据用途,获取书面同意。
- 匿名化处理数据(如仅存储特征向量,不关联个人信息)。
### 三、人脸识别网址的安全实践:从数据保护到合规
#### 3.1 数据加密与传输安全
人脸特征数据属于敏感信息,需采用AES-256等强加密算法存储,传输时使用HTTPS协议。例如,某服务在API响应中返回加密后的特征向量,客户端需通过密钥解密。
**代码示例(加密存储)**:
```python
from cryptography.fernet import Fernet
key = Fernet.generate_key()
cipher = Fernet(key)
encrypted_data = cipher.encrypt(b"128_dim_face_feature") # 加密特征向量
print("Encrypted data:", encrypted_data)
3.2 活体检测:防范照片与视频攻击
活体检测技术包括:
- 动作指令:要求用户完成指定动作(如张嘴)。
- 红外检测:通过红外摄像头区分真实人脸与屏幕反射。
- 3D结构光:利用激光投影构建面部深度图(如iPhone Face ID)。
测试建议: - 使用打印照片、视频回放、3D面具等攻击方式验证系统鲁棒性。
3.3 合规与伦理:遵循GDPR与《个人信息保护法》
开发者需注意: - 最小化收集:仅收集实现功能所需的最少数据。
- 用户权利:提供数据删除、更正的接口。
- 审计日志:记录所有数据访问与操作行为。
四、未来趋势:多模态融合与轻量化
4.1 多模态识别:人脸+声纹+行为
未来系统可能结合人脸、声纹、步态等多维度特征,提升在复杂环境下的准确性。例如,某研究通过融合人脸与步态特征,在跨视角场景下识别率提升20%。
4.2 轻量化模型:嵌入式设备部署
为适应物联网设备,模型需压缩至几MB甚至更小。例如,MobileFaceNet通过深度可分离卷积减少参数量,在ARM CPU上推理速度达50fps。
结语:技术向善,责任先行
人脸识别网址的技术潜力巨大,但需以安全、合规、伦理为前提。开发者应持续关注技术演进,同时建立完善的数据治理体系,确保技术真正服务于社会福祉。
发表评论
登录后可评论,请前往 登录 或 注册